321H stainless steel tubing is a general purpose austenitic stainless steel stabilized against carbide precipitation and designed for use in the carbide precipitation temperature range of 800 to 1500°F (427 to 816°C). It becomes non-magnetic when annealed and only hardens when cold worked.

Grades 321 is and 347 are the basic austenitic 18/8 steel (Grade 304) stabilised by Titanium (321) or Niobium (347) additions. These grades are used because they are not sensitive to intergranular corrosion after heating within the carbide precipitation range of 425-850°C. Grade 321 is the grade of choice for applications in the temperature range of up to about 900°C, combining high strength, resistance to scaling and phase stability with resistance to subsequent aqueous corrosion.
Grade 321H is a modification of 321 with a higher carbon content, to provide improved high temperature strength. A limitation with 321 Titanium does not transfer well across a High Temperature arc, so is not recommended as a welding consumable. In this case grade 347 Stainless is preferred - the niobium performs the same carbide stabilisation task but can be transferred across a welding arc.
321H Stainless Steel Pipes and Tube is therefore the standard consumable for welding 321. Grade 347 is only occasionally used as parent plate material. Like other austenitic grades, 321 and 347 have excellent forming and welding characteristics, are readily brake or roll formed and have outstanding welding characteristics. Post-weld annealing is not required. They also have excellent toughness, even down to cryogenic temperatures. Grade 321 does not polish well, so is not recommended for decorative applications.
Grade 304L and Stainless Steel Products is more readily available in most product forms, and so is generally used in preference to 321 if the requirement is simply for resistance to intergranular corrosion after welding. However SS 304 has lower hot strength than 321 and so is not the best choice if the requirement is resistance to an operating environment over about 500°C.

The Chemical Composition of grade 321H Stainless Steel is outlined in the following tableTypical compositional ranges for grade 321 Stainless steels Pipes
| Grade | C | Mn | Si | P | S | Cr | Mo | Ni | N | Other | |
| 321 | min. max |
- 0.08 |
2.00 | 0.75 | 0.045 | 0.030 | 17.0 19.0 |
- | 9.0 12.0 |
0.10 | Ti=5(C+N) 0.70 |
| 321H | min. max |
0.04 0.10 |
2.00 | 0.75 | 0.045 | 0.030 | 17.0 19.0 |
- | 9.0 12.0 |
- | Ti=4(C+N) 0.70 |
The Mechanical Properties of grade Stainless Steel 321H are displayed in the following table.
| Grade | Tensile Strength (MPa) min | Yield Strength 0.2% Proof (MPa) min | Elongation (% in 50mm) min | Hardness | |
| Rockwell B (HR B) max | Brinell (HB) max | ||||
| 321 | 515 | 205 | 40 | 95 | 217 |
| 321H | 515 | 205 | 40 | 95 | 217 |
| 321H also has a requirement for a grain size of ASTM No 7 or coarser. | |||||
Physical properties of 321H grade stainless steel in the annealed condition
| Grade | Density (kg/m3) | Elastic Modulus (GPa) | Mean Coefficient of Thermal Expansion (μm/m/°C) | Thermal Conductivity (W/m.K) | Specific Heat 0-100°C (J/kg.K) | Electrical Resistivity (nΩ.m) | |||
| 0-100°C | 0-315°C | 0-538°C | at 100°C | at 500°C | |||||
| 321 | 8027 | 193 | 16.6 | 17.2 | 18.6 | 16.1 | 22.2 | 500 | 720 |
Grade Specifications for 321H grade stainless steel
| Grade | UNS No | Old British | Euronorm | Swedish SS | Japanese JIS | ||
| BS | En | No | Name | ||||
| 321 | S32100 | 321S31 | 58B, 58C | 1.4541 | X6CrNiTi18-10 | 2337 | SUS 321 |
| 321H | S32109 | 321S51 | - | 1.4878 | X10CrNiTi18-10 | - | SUS 321H |
| 347 | S34700 | 347S31 | 58G | 1.4550 | X6CrNiNb18-10 | 2338 | SUS 347 |
| These comparisons are approximate only. The list is intended as a comparison of functionally similar materials not as a schedule of contractual equivalents. If exact equivalents are needed original specifications must be consulted. | |||||||
